| Patch 7.2.152 |
| Problem: When using "silent echo x" inside ":redir" a next echo may start |
| halfway the line. (Tony Mechelynck, Dennis Benzinger) |
| Solution: Reset msg_col after redirecting silently. |
| Files: src/ex_docmd.c, src/message.c, src/proto/message.pro |
